PRESIDENT GRAHAME O'DONNELL STEPS DOWN

28 days ago

On Monday, March 25th at the 125th Annual General Meeting at North Sydney Oval, after six years as President and a combined eighteen years at Northern Suburbs in Coaching, Director and Rugby Director positions, Grahame O’Donnell stepped down as President.

Grahame (Hound) O’Donnell is part of the furniture at Northern Suburbs with his infectious energy, approachable nature, and love for the game of rugby. You can often find him walking up and down the sidelines riding the highs and lows of matches throughout the season.

Grahame has now moved to a position on the Sydney Rugby Union Board after fellow club presidents nominated him for a vacant position in late 2023.

On behalf of everyone at Northern Suburbs, we’d like to thank you for your outstanding work and wish you nothing but success in your new position with the SRU.

With Grahame’s resignation, Brad Leahy has stepped up as President. Brad has been part of the Club for nearly ten years in various roles, including CEO during the transition away from Cabana Bar and Treasurer when reshaping the financial strength of the Club. However, Brad’s main role over the last few years has been Grahame’s right-hand man.

Brad has been side by side with Grahame over the years and has supported him through some fantastic times at Northern Suburbs, including our premiership in 2016 and reaching the preliminary finals every year since then. Despite having not played rugby, Brad has developed a strong understanding of the Shute Shield, its challenges, and opportunities over the years working alongside Grahame.

Brad works in Private Equity and has a strong business acumen and understanding of professional sport that will be a great asset in the role of Northern Suburbs President.

Importantly, under Grahame’s stewardship, the Club has established itself as one of the leading clubs in the competition with a Board, a GM, coaches, players, volunteers, partners and members that are the envy of many. Brad, together with this strong team, will ensure the Club continues to compete at the highest of levels, provides a pathway to professional rugby for aspirational coaches, players and staff and continues a culture that produces lifelong memories!

On behalf of everyone at Northern Suburbs, congratulations Brad Leahy on your new role as Northern Suburbs President.
